Limewire is a service, and is not illegal. Downloading or sharing anything covered by copyright (music, software, movies etc) is illegal. It's a violation of international copyright law, punishable by fines of up to $150,000 per song/software/movie or whatever. The RIAA has been zealously prosecuting people for sharing and downloading music. So far they have filed lawsuits against almost 20,000 people and have won almost 100% of the cases. Since the average fine would be millions of dollars, most of those charged settle for a smaller amount, usually $10,000 - $20,000, although some have paid more.
